All About Abra Service in Ajman
Lying on the coastline of the Arabian Gulf, Ajman offers a peaceful getaway, making it an ideal spot to relax and unwind. One of the most scenic ways to experience the emirate’s coastal beauty is through the Abra service – a traditional boat service with a modern touch. It combines tradition with contemporary needs by offering an efficient and eco-friendly transportation option.
The Ajman Abra service connects different parts of the emirate. Here’s what you should know about the service, including its timings, routes and stations.
An Overview of the Abra Service in Ajman

The modern abra service in Ajman is among the various public transport options in Ajman, providing safe, reliable and eco-friendly sea transportation. Apart from offering convenient transport, it allows the passengers to enjoy the emirate’s scenic coastal views. Let’s take a look at the key details of this unique service.
Types of Abras in Ajman
Ajman operates two types of abras:
- Large Abra: Accommodates up to 25 passengers
- Small Abra: Accommodates up to 15 passengers
Both types are equipped with modern safety features such as radios, solar-powered lighting lamps, life jackets, lifebuoys, first aid kits and fire extinguishers for enhanced passenger safety.
Abra Stations in Ajman
The Ajman abra service operates at several stations throughout the emirate, including:
- Al Zorah
- Al Rashidiya
- Marina Station
Operating Hours
The operating hours of Ajman abra rides are as follows:
Al Zorah and Al Rashidiya Stations
- Saturday to Thursday from 6:00 AM to 10:00 PM
- Friday from 5:00 PM to 10:00 PM
Marina Station
- Saturday to Wednesday from 5:00 PM to 10:00 PM
- Thursday and Friday from 5:00 PM to 12:00 midnight
Ticketing and Fares
Abra in Ajman offers flexible and affordable rates set to cater to different travel needs:
- AED 2 per person for transfers between stations
- AED 50 for a 30-minute trip
- AED 100 for a 60-minute trip
- AED 150 for a 90-minute trip
Passengers can pay for the ride using cash or the Masaar Card, an electronic payment method widely accepted in Ajman’s public transport system.
How to Use the Abra Service

Using the abra service in Ajman is simple and user-friendly. Follow the steps mentioned below to buy a ticket:
- Head to the closest Abra station.
- Pay the fare to the station employee.
- Receive your ticket.
- Board the abra.
- Disembark at your desired destination.
